What Makes a Great TikTok PFP?

While creativity and personal expression reign supreme, there are key factors to consider when choosing your pfp:

  • Clarity and Recognition: Ensure your pfp is clear and recognizable, even when displayed in its small size. Avoid blurry images or excessive cropping that obscures your face or key details.
  • Color and Contrast: Opt for vibrant colors and high contrast to make your pfp pop. This is especially important if your profile picture features multiple elements or blends into the background.
  • Alignment with Your Content: Your pfp should complement the type of content you create. If you’re a comedy creator, a funny photo might be appropriate, while a more serious creator might opt for a professional headshot.
  • Following Community Guidelines: Remember to follow TikTok’s Community Guidelines when choosing your pfp. Avoid images that are offensive, inappropriate, or infringe on copyrights.

Beyond the Basics: Pro Tips for PFP Creation

  • High-Quality Photography: While a selfie from your phone camera can work, consider using a higher-quality camera for a professional and polished look. Ensure proper lighting and focus to capture a clear and crisp image.
  • Framing and Cropping: Pay attention to how your image is framed and cropped. Centering your face or object of interest is generally recommended.
  • Background Choice: A solid or simple background can help your pfp stand out. Avoid busy backgrounds that might distract viewers.
  • Consistent Branding: If you have a specific brand or aesthetic associated with your content, consider incorporating elements of that into your pfp for a cohesive look.
  • Regular Updates: As your style or content evolves, don’t be afraid to update your pfp to reflect your current persona.
